• Steam recently changed the default privacy settings for all users. This may impact tracking. Ensure your profile has the correct settings by following the guide on our forums.

I only see the last games played


Staff member
Enforcer Team
Game Info Editor
I've just forced an update for your profile. You'll need to wait a bit for a full sync. Usually it's quicker but we've been getting a massive amount of signups today.